study for the importance of being simone de beauvoir

drawings and video (23’08”, colour, sound)

this video piece marks the culmination of the initial research phase for the performance ‘the importance of being simone de beauvoir’. created during an artistic residency at menu spastuve (arts printing house) in vilnius, lithuania, in july 2013, it represents a pivotal stage in the development of the performance.
the twelve drawings served as a visual roadmap for the video shoot. subsequently, they were exhibited as a unified piece at the ‘gender in art: body, sexuality, identity, resistance’ exhibition at the national museum of contemporary art – museu do chiado in lisbon.
